Democratic Alternative (Republic of Macedonia)

The Democratic Alternative (Macedonian: Демократска алтернатива, ДА, Demokratska Alternativa) or DA is a centrist political party in the Republic of Macedonia. The Democratic Alternative was formed in March 1998 by Vasil Tupurkovski, charismatic member of the last Presidency of the former Yugoslavia.
